How smart kitchen devices promote sustainability

Smart kitchen devices play a critical role in promoting sustainable practices through automation and connectivity. IoT-powered appliances, such as refrigerators and ovens, monitor energy usage and adapt to user behaviors to optimize efficiency. Many of these devices are created with recycled materials, reaffirming the commitment to environmental responsibility. Smart refrigerators, for example, come with features that track food inventory, suggesting recipes to prevent waste.

The use of recycled materials in kitchen design

Recycled materials are becoming a staple in modern kitchen designs, combining eco-friendliness with chic aesthetics. Reclaimed wood, recycled glass, and reconstituted stone are among the top choices for countertops and cabinetry. These materials don’t just look good; they’re sustainable alternatives that minimize the environmental impact of kitchen renovations.

Wist je dat? Recycled steel requires 75% less energy to produce than new steel, making it a popular choice for sustainable appliance manufacturing.

Builders often opt for recycled metals in fixtures and fittings, significantly cutting down the carbon emissions associated with traditional mining and refining processes. Additionally, digital recycling systems integrated into smart devices can track and suggest optimal recycling methods for discarded materials, reducing kitchen waste.

Automation and smart recycling in kitchens

Automation transforms mundane recycling tasks into efficient processes with minimal human intervention. Smart bins equipped with separators classify waste, optimizing recycling efforts. These automated solutions are part of a larger IoT ecosystem where appliances communicate, enhancing overall sustainability strategies.

Connected kitchen systems can alert users when a recycling bin is full or when composting material needs disposing, effectively creating a zero-waste environment. Energy-efficient smart appliances: An eco-friendly choice

Energy-efficient smart appliances are a hallmark of sustainable kitchens, harnessing IoT technology to fine-tune power consumption. Appliances like induction stoves and smart ovens preheat only when needed and switch off automatically when idle, conserving energy effortlessly.

Energy Efficiency: The practice of using less energy to provide the same level of energy service. It is one of the key solutions to reducing carbon emissions and protecting the environment.

The energy saved by these smart devices translates into reduced utility bills, proving that environmentally-friendly options do not compromise on economic savings. Veelgestelde vragen

How do IoT devices help in reducing kitchen waste?

IoT devices monitor food inventories and suggest recipes to reduce waste, while smart bins automate waste separation and alert users when to dispose of compostables.

Are smart kitchens expensive to maintain?

While initial costs may be higher, smart kitchens offer savings long-term via reduced energy bills and food waste, offsetting upfront investments.

Can smart appliances be integrated into older kitchens?

Yes, smart appliances and devices can be retrofitted into existing kitchens, although some renovations might be required for optimal efficiency.

What’s the benefit of using recycled materials in kitchens?

Using recycled materials reduces environmental impact, lowers carbon footprints, and provides durable, often cost-effective, alternatives to traditional materials.
